Why Is Cranberry Juice So Tart?

The cranberry is both sour and bitter. It has less than 4 percent sugar. If you’ve ever tasted a fresh cranberry, or tried to drink 100% pure cranberry juice, you know that it’s hardly palatable. The compounds in cranberries that make them taste so brutal are an antioxidant family know as tannins.

Why are cranberries so tart?

However, because of their notoriously bitter, sharp taste, most people prefer not to eat them raw or unsweetened. This bitterness is due to the high tannin content of cranberries. Tannins are a plant compound also found in high amounts in coffee, wine, and dark chocolate ( 2 , 4 ).

Why Does cranberry juice have a bitter aftertaste?

Tannins are what gives cranberries and red wine that bitter flavor and different mouth feel from most drinks. Grape peels have a similar flavor (which is where the tannins in red wine are from). Whatever you do to the cranberry juice may blend with the flavors in general, but the tannins are not going to go away.

How do you reduce tartness in cranberry sauce?

Mix equal parts sugar and water and bring it to a boil until it forms a semi-thick syrup. Add this to your sauce to reduce the tartness of the berries. You can also add a teaspoon of honey to cut through the tartness if you desire.

Is 100 cranberry juice tart?

All our 100% juice products contain 100% juice. Unlike other fruits, cranberry juice is not naturally sweet. In fact, similar to lemon or lime juice, cranberry juice is much too tart to drink straight. This means that it must be sweetened to make it palatable.

How much cranberry juice should you drink a day for your kidneys?

Cranberry juice has been thought to help with kidney stones, but research suggests that it may actually increase kidney stones formation — especially calcium oxalate stones, which are the most common kidney stones. Ideally, you should try to limit your juice intake to around one cup (236 mL) or less per day.

When should you not drink cranberry juice?

Cranberry juice should be used with caution if you have the following conditions: Diabetes: Sweetened cranberry juice can cause blood sugar spikes due to the presence of added sugar. Kidney stones: Cranberry juice is high in oxalates, which can lead to kidney stones.
